Jon Brodkin / Ars Technica:
Red Hat and CentOS become Voltron, build free operating system together  —  Team Voltron, defender of open source.  —  World Events Productions  —  Red Hat and the CentOS Project today said they will team up to build what they called “a new CentOS” in a bid to accelerate adoption of the free operating system.

Andrew Longstreth / Reuters:
Apple seeks removal of court-appointed antitrust monitor  —  (Reuters) - Apple Inc is seeking the removal of a lawyer appointed by a court to monitor its antitrust compliance following a ruling last year that the company had conspired to fix e-book prices.  —  An attorney for the consumer …
Mark Mazzetti / New York Times:
Anonymous burglars who exposed FBI's spying program in 1971 come forward for the first time  —  Burglars Who Took on F.B.I. Abandon Shadows  —  Stealing J. Edgar Hoover's Secrets: One night in 1971, files were stolen from an F.B.I. office near Philadelphia.  They proved that the bureau was spying on thousands of Americans.
